Understanding Missouri's Laws on School Sexual Assault

In Missouri, particularly within the legal jurisdiction of Kansas City MO, understanding the laws surrounding school sexual assault is paramount for ensuring justice and support for victims. The state has enacted legislation to protect students from sexual misconduct, including policies that mandate reporting, investigation, and accountability for perpetrators. It’s crucial for both victims and advocates to be aware that Missouri law requires schools to have policies in place to address and prevent sexual abuse, offering a framework for holding institutions and individuals accountable.
Victims of school sexual assault in Kansas City MO have legal rights and options. Engaging the services of a skilled school abuse attorney can navigate these complex laws, providing guidance on reporting the incident, pursuing criminal charges, or taking civil action to seek compensation and justice. With knowledgeable representation, victims can access resources, receive support, and ensure that their experiences are acknowledged and addressed appropriately within the legal system.
